After a successful action at NPower, what next?

On Tuesday 26th November about 250 people, and countless cameras, gathered in the heart of London to march to NPower’s supply and trading offices. Protesters gathered with banners, a coffin, masks of fuel poverty perpetrators David Cameron, George Osborne, Ed Davey and CEO of NPower Paul Massara.
